Sample Answer
In today’s digital age, the importance of books has experienced a significant transformation. While traditional printed books continue to hold intrinsic value, especially in terms of tactile reading experiences and the aesthetic pleasure they provide, there has been a marked shift towards digital formats, such as eBooks and audiobooks.
This shift can be ascribed largely to the convenience and accessibility that digital content offers; readers can now access vast libraries at their fingertips, promoting the democratization of knowledge. However, one could argue that this convenience comes at the cost of deep engagement; the immersion that physical books provide often fosters a more profound understanding of the material.
Consequently, while the role of books is evolving, it is imperative to recognize that they still serve as a cornerstone for literacy and critical thinking, irrespective of the medium through which they are consumed.
